What does it mean to be quantized?

Quantization refers to the process of approximating continuous values with discrete values. In physics, it often pertains to the quantization of physical quantities like energy or charge into discrete levels. In digital signal processing, quantization refers to converting analog signals into digital format by rounding or approximating data values to a set number of bits.

What is the Different between sampling and quantization?

Sampling Discritizes in time Quantization discritizes in amplitude
